English Translation
It was narrated from 'Abdullah ibn 'Amr (رضي الله عنهما) — via Waki', from al-A'mash, from Zayd ibn Wahb, from 'Abd al-Rahman ibn 'Abd Rabb al-Ka'ba — that the Messenger of Allah ﷺ said: 'Whoever wishes to be kept away from the Fire and to enter Paradise — let death find him while he believes in Allah and the Last Day, and while he treats people the way he wishes to be treated.'
